In a city renowned for gadflies that make pop-rap weirdness, Future stands out. The ATLien used to be a Dungeon Family protégé, but only an introduction from Big Rube on Pluto hints at those days. Now, he strains and flattens his voice so it sounds like an Auto-Tune effect on "Magic," parodies Al Pacino's gruff bark on "Tony Montana," and shouts out coke-rap clichés on "Same Damn Time." It's hard to tell if he's joking, which is why it's so memorable. Pluto is split between those oddball songs and, less effectively, semi-serious forays into urban pop via "Astronaut Chick."
- Mosi Reeves
